Louisiana Approves Racketeering Charges for Illegal Gambling

Louisiana lawmakers have taken a significant step toward addressing illegal gambling, including sweepstakes casinos, with the passage of House Bill 53 (HB 53). This new legislation classifies certain gambling offenses as racketeering activity under the Louisiana Racketeering Act, carrying severe penalties for those convicted.
